Output 7bc5d861dbc37a3f8510ae0f382a5d862c68a1e0044e11892b31df8dde29b523:2

value
22289080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52b3c4863121dd8a7597821da5455c4b0e4e4dd9 OP_EQUAL
address
MFSSzducrTYgYjzxJix2XefMGCLuEfxJbX
transaction
7bc5d861dbc37a3f8510ae0f382a5d862c68a1e0044e11892b31df8dde29b523
spent
true